Fyi, RFCs are available in PDF as follows. (Named ".txt.pdf" at the time they started being posted 12 years ago, as it's a PDF of simply the text - no links.)

Rsync: rsync ftp.rfc-editor.org::rfcs-pdf-only
Tarballs: http://www.rfc-editor.org/download.html
Example: http://www.rfc-editor.org/pdfrfc/rfc2026.txt.pdf

Also, when printing from http://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c2026 (for example) in the browser, the page breaks are preserved.
